(Node.js) Decrypt File in Chunks using 256-bit AESSee more Encryption ExamplesShows how to decrypt a file chunk-by-chunk using FirstChunk/LastChunk properties and accumulate the results in memory with a Chilkat BinData object.
var os = require('os'); if (os.platform() == 'win32') { var chilkat = require('@chilkat/ck-node23-win64'); } else if (os.platform() == 'linux') { if (os.arch() == 'arm') { var chilkat = require('@chilkat/ck-node23-linux-arm'); } else if (os.arch() == 'arm64') { var chilkat = require('@chilkat/ck-node23-linux-arm64'); } else { var chilkat = require('@chilkat/ck-node23-linux-x64'); } } else if (os.platform() == 'darwin') { var chilkat = require('@chilkat/ck-node23-mac-universal'); } function chilkatExample() { var success = false; // This example assumes the Chilkat API to have been previously unlocked. // See Global Unlock Sample for sample code. // This example decrypts the file previously encrypted in this example: // Encrypt File in Chunks using AES CBC var crypt = new chilkat.Crypt2(); crypt.CryptAlgorithm = "aes"; crypt.CipherMode = "cbc"; crypt.KeyLength = 256; crypt.SetEncodedKey("000102030405060708090A0B0C0D0E0F000102030405060708090A0B0C0D0E0F","hex"); crypt.SetEncodedIV("000102030405060708090A0B0C0D0E0F","hex"); var fileToDecrypt = "c:/temp/qa_output/hamlet.enc"; var facIn = new chilkat.FileAccess(); success = facIn.OpenForRead(fileToDecrypt); if (success !== true) { console.log("Failed to open file to be decrytped."); return; } // Let's decrypt in 32000 byte chunks. var chunkSize = 32000; var numChunks = facIn.GetNumBlocks(chunkSize); crypt.FirstChunk = true; crypt.LastChunk = false; var bd = new chilkat.BinData(); var bdDecrypted = new chilkat.BinData(); var i = 0; while (i < numChunks) { i = i+1; if (i == numChunks) { crypt.LastChunk = true; } // Read the next chunk from the file. // The last chunk will be whatever amount remains in the file.. bd.Clear(); facIn.FileReadBd(chunkSize,bd); // Decrypt this chunk. crypt.DecryptBd(bd); // Accumulate the decrypted chunks. bdDecrypted.AppendBd(bd); crypt.FirstChunk = false; } // Make sure both FirstChunk and LastChunk are restored to true after // encrypting or decrypting in chunks. Otherwise subsequent encryptions/decryptions // will produce unexpected results. crypt.FirstChunk = true; crypt.LastChunk = true; facIn.FileClose(); // The fully decrypted file is contained in bdDecrypted. // You can save to a file if desired, or use the decrypted data in your application directly from bdDecrypted. bdDecrypted.WriteFile("c:/temp/qa_output/hamlet_decrypted.xml"); } chilkatExample(); |
